Rustler Conceptual Model4
West(Nash Draw)EastWest of WIPPShallow unitsHigh
permeabilityRelatively fresh waterEast of WIPPDeeper unitsLow
permeabilitySaturated brineRegional groundwaterFlow used in WIPP
PALong-term geological stability of salt
Corbet (2000) WIPP Model5Most of Delaware BasinTransient
SimulationClimate variation (dry vs. wet)14,000 y present 10,000
yModel Implementationwater table moving boundary model~8700 km2
region (78 km 112 km)Coarse mesh (2 km square cells)12 model layers
(10 geo layers)1,500 cells/layer~18,000 elements total

df++ 2016 Simulationsdensity-driven flow, free water tablegrid
level 1 (217 000 prisms) and level 2 (900 000 prisms)21velocity
water table
df++ 2016
Current work:new BMWi-funded project GRUSS (April 2016)improve
robustness of solvers (convergence, timesteps)implement volume of
fluid (VOF) method to speed-up free surface handling
